Block

#21,069,095
Block Number
21,069,095 @ 03/06/2025, 24:11:40
Status
Finalized
ID
0x01417d27db78df457de9a505468fa266385c736e27239760ed2abbe2799a2375
Transactions
Gas Used
9875502/40000000 (24.69% Used)
Total Score
2,057,031,955 (+98)
Rewards
40.38 VTHO